For the first time in his career, Luke Hampton scored a receiving touchdown on Friday. He picked up 69 receiving yards and one score as East Chambers took down Kirbyville 58-52. We think that's the best game he's posted since October 2nd, when he made ten total tackles (1.0 for loss).
Looking ahead, Hampton and East Chambers will look to defend their home field on Friday against Orangefield at 7:30 p.m. Thanks in part to Hampton's efforts, the Buccaneers will roll in on a three-game winning streak.
